## Releases

Restockr builds ship monthly. Support pulls signed bundles from the internal artifact shelf only — never from dev branches. Each release notes the planner ruleset version; confirm it matches the customer's machine fleet before advising an update. Verify every bundle signature before forwarding. Verification requires the current release key, provided below.

rollout seal: bky9_PeXH1fTLY

**Vendor note: Inkmill markdown pipeline**

Rendering for Parchway docs is outsourced to Inkmill under an annual contract, renewing each March. They handle sanitization and PDF export; we own the upload queue. SLA: 4-hour response on rendering failures. Escalate only after two failed retries. Their support desk is reachable at the address below.

billing contact of hahaf-baguf = zorael.tammir.jorius@sivrelhq.internal

Ticket #4471 — Connection failures updating static-analysis baseline

The Brackenmoor lint service keeps timing out while writing the refreshed baseline file to its results database. Retries exhaust after three attempts and the baseline stays stale, so new findings get flagged as regressions. Please verify connectivity from the runner host using the connection string below.

replica DSN, kajep-yahag: mssql://praok_svc:iF@db-8d68.plorvaio.local:5432/eliion

**Thornpike Scanner — onboarding notes**

Scanner watches registry feeds for typo-squats of our internal packages. Runs hourly. Config lives in `scanner.env`. Tune SIMILARITY_THRESHOLD (default 0.85) before raising alert noise at sync. Flagged packages land in the quarantine queue; triage within 24h. The feed poller needs an auth token to read the private registry mirror, set on the next line.

env line for fafof-fahag: LEDGER_TOKEN5=f8790